Light butter bread
Overview
This whipped cream puff pastry is very soft, and the preparation is not complicated. The salt and sugar are added after the dough is fermented, and the dough is easy to form. Both adults and children like it. The original amount of milk was 38 grams. After checking the water absorption of the flour, I added about 15 grams. When I made it the second time, I measured it and used exactly 50 grams of milk. Therefore, the amount of milk should be added or subtracted according to the water absorption of each flour. Ingredients 1: 250g flour, 40g whole eggs, 38g + 15g milk, 90g whipping cream, 4g yeast Ingredients 2: 60g soft sugar, 2g salt

Prepare ingredients.
-
Follow the bread machine usage program for ingredient 2, and add the egg liquid, milk, and whipped cream into the bread machine.
-
Add bread flour and yeast.
-
Knead into a smooth dough.
-
Let the dough rise until doubled in size.
-
Take out the fermented dough, tear it into small pieces, and add ingredient 2: sugar and salt.
-
Then knead the dough until it is fully expanded. The pulled out membrane is not easy to puncture, or the edge of the punctured eye is smooth. Knead the dough and put it back into the bread machine to ferment for 15 to 20 minutes.
-
Take out the fermented dough, turn the bottom side up, fold and deflate.
-
Divide the deflated dough into 9 portions. Round. Put it into the mold for secondary fermentation.
-
Let the bread dough ferment until 1.5 or 2 times in size. Sprinkle with egg wash and sprinkle with sesame seeds.
-
Preheat the oven to 175 degrees and bake for about 15 to 20 minutes. It depends on the temperament of your own oven.
